How long is the CNE exam?
There are 150 multiple-choice questions on the test, 20 of which are unscored and are being tested for future exams. You will have 3 hours to complete the exam. The CNE exam evaluates you on three cognitive areas: recall, application and analysis: Recall: Recall or recognize specific information.

How do you get MCNE?
The MCNE® designation is awarded to students who successfully complete both the CNE Core Concepts course and the CNE Advanced Concepts course. The CNE Core Concepts course must be taken before the CNE Advanced Concepts course.
What does CNE mean in Canada?
The Canadian National Exhibition (CNE), also known as The Exhibition or The Ex, is an annual event that takes place at Exhibition Place in Toronto, Ontario, Canada, on the third Friday of August leading up to and including Canadian Labour Day, the first Monday in September.
What does CNE stand for Toronto?
The Canadian National Exhibition (CNE) is Canada’s largest community event and one of the top agricultural fairs in North America. Founded in 1879 as the Toronto Industrial Exhibition, the CNE is a not-for-profit organization that has enjoyed a distinguished history as a showcase of the nation.

How much are rides at CNE?
General admission does not include tickets to Midway rides, which are sold separately. Get four ride tickets for $5, 20 for $22 and 55 for $55. Each ride requires four-to-eight tickets, unless you get a ride-all-day pass, which gives you access to unlimited rides.

Is CNE cash only?
Debit and credit machines are not mandatory for CNE vendors. They use them at their own discretion and many vendors accept cash only. There are ATMs available throughout the grounds and in most buildings.
Can you drink at the CNE?
Guest Policies. You may not bring alcohol into the CNE grounds. It can be purchased in licensed areas within the CNE.

What days are the CNE Open?
The grounds are open from 10 am to midnight, except on Labour Day. On Labour Day (September 5) the grounds are open from 10 am to 9 pm, and the gates close at 5 pm. The Midway is open from 11 am to midnight on weekdays and 10 am to midnight on weekends.
Who owns the CNE?
Canadian National Exhibition Association (CNEA)
Founded in 1879, the CNE is an 18-day fair that takes place in late summer leading up to, and including, Labour Day. In 2013, the CNEA became financially independent of Exhibition Place and the City of Toronto.
